diff options
Diffstat (limited to 'test')
-rw-r--r-- | test/scenario_test/constant.py | 2 | ||||
-rw-r--r-- | test/scenario_test/gobgp_test.py | 8 | ||||
-rw-r--r-- | test/scenario_test/route_server_malformed_test.py | 2 |
3 files changed, 7 insertions, 5 deletions
diff --git a/test/scenario_test/constant.py b/test/scenario_test/constant.py index 131cfd04..a5132022 100644 --- a/test/scenario_test/constant.py +++ b/test/scenario_test/constant.py @@ -62,5 +62,5 @@ A_PART_OF_CURRENT_DIR = "/test/scenario_test" ADJ_RIB_IN = "adj-in" ADJ_RIB_OUT = "adj-out" LOCAL_RIB = "local" -GLOBAL_RIB = "global" +GLOBAL_RIB = "global rib" NEIGHBOR = "neighbor" diff --git a/test/scenario_test/gobgp_test.py b/test/scenario_test/gobgp_test.py index d3bcdc21..5498275e 100644 --- a/test/scenario_test/gobgp_test.py +++ b/test/scenario_test/gobgp_test.py @@ -186,7 +186,8 @@ class GoBGPTestBase(unittest.TestCase): return True def ask_gobgp(self, what, who="", af="ipv4"): - cmd = "%s/%s -j -u %s -p %s show " % (CONFIG_DIR, CLI_CMD, self.gobgp_ip, self.gobgp_port) + af = "-a %s" % af + cmd = "%s/%s -j -u %s -p %s " % (CONFIG_DIR, CLI_CMD, self.gobgp_ip, self.gobgp_port) if what == GLOBAL_RIB: cmd += " ".join([what, af]) elif what == NEIGHBOR: @@ -198,8 +199,9 @@ class GoBGPTestBase(unittest.TestCase): return result def soft_reset(self, neighbor_address, route_family, type="in"): - cmd = "%s/%s -j -u %s -p %s softreset%s " % (CONFIG_DIR, CLI_CMD, self.gobgp_ip, self.gobgp_port, type) - cmd += "neighbor %s %s" % (neighbor_address, route_family) + cmd = "%s/%s -j -u %s -p %s " % (CONFIG_DIR, CLI_CMD, self.gobgp_ip, self.gobgp_port) + cmd += "neighbor %s " % neighbor_address + cmd += "softreset%s -a %s" % (type, route_family) local(cmd) def get_paths_in_localrib(self, neighbor_address, target_prefix, retry=3, interval=5): diff --git a/test/scenario_test/route_server_malformed_test.py b/test/scenario_test/route_server_malformed_test.py index ab8993ae..ab1f12bd 100644 --- a/test/scenario_test/route_server_malformed_test.py +++ b/test/scenario_test/route_server_malformed_test.py @@ -116,7 +116,7 @@ def check_func(exabgp_conf, result): retry_count += 1 # check whether the service of gobgp is normally try: - cmd = "%s/%s -j -u %s -p %s show neighbors" % (CONFIG_DIR, CLI_CMD, gobgp_ip, gobgp_port) + cmd = "%s/%s -j -u %s -p %s neighbor" % (CONFIG_DIR, CLI_CMD, gobgp_ip, gobgp_port) j = local(cmd, capture=True) neighbors = json.loads(j) except Exception: |